Understanding Different Types of Automatic Tin Can Making Machines

When selecting an automatic tin can making machine, it's crucial to understand the different types available. There are primarily three categories: rotary, vertical, and horizontal machines. Each has its own features and capabilities. Rotary machines are known for their speed and efficiency. They can produce a large number of cans in a short time. This is ideal for high-demand production environments. However, maintenance can be challenging due to their complex structure.

Vertical machines tend to be more compact. They require less floor space, making them suitable for smaller operations. Their design is straightforward, which often makes repairs easier. Yet, they might not achieve the same output as rotary models. On the other hand, horizontal machines offer flexibility in handling various can sizes. They are versatile but can be slower. Additionally, operators might need to adapt frequently to changes in demand.

It's essential to evaluate your production needs carefully. Consider factors like output capacity and space constraints. Think about the potential need for future upgrades or changes in product lines. Each machine type has its pros and cons, and the decision is not always clear-cut. Assessing the Reliability and Durability of Can Making Equipment

Choosing the right automatic tin can making machine involves careful consideration of reliability and durability. Industry reports indicate that over 30% of machinery failures stem from poor maintenance practices. Regular checks on the equipment can prevent breakdowns and enhance longevity. For instance, using high-quality materials in construction can increase the lifespan of a machine significantly.

When evaluating can making equipment, assess the build quality and materials used. Aluminum and stainless steel are preferred choices due to their resistance to corrosion. A machine made of these materials typically lasts longer and requires less frequent replacements. Many operators overlook the importance of regular maintenance, which can lead to unexpected costs.
